Transaction 21594f29ca5156731ba7b676282ec1475f61be6a5f8e113cf2fb4c922842843c

2 Input
2 Outputs
  • 21594f29ca5156731ba7b676282ec1475f61be6a5f8e113cf2fb4c922842843c:0
  • value  2207000
    address  3PiCGEfzaDEe3v3TKmG6iYZNBzJakGbjBw
  • 21594f29ca5156731ba7b676282ec1475f61be6a5f8e113cf2fb4c922842843c:1
  • value  2311542
    address  3EtaSei8rLi9NArYc2oGcX6CGdAF1jdGKF